summaryrefslogtreecommitdiff
path: root/Makefile.inc1
diff options
context:
space:
mode:
authorJohn Baldwin <jhb@FreeBSD.org>2020-01-02 21:34:44 +0000
committerJohn Baldwin <jhb@FreeBSD.org>2020-01-02 21:34:44 +0000
commit39eb07f172921a581ee9b33ca2765905f4235202 (patch)
tree0ade8e9e31d21098b0b103ec5b75483280a4fbc2 /Makefile.inc1
parent0aabbeff36be90aec5afdd8704eeeda57bb36690 (diff)
downloadsrc-test-39eb07f172921a581ee9b33ca2765905f4235202.tar.gz
src-test-39eb07f172921a581ee9b33ca2765905f4235202.zip
Look for cross toolchain makefiles in /usr/share/toolchains.
The freebsd-binutils and freebsd-gcc* packages install toolchain makefiles to /usr/share/toolchains rather than LOCALBASE. Reviewed by: bapt Differential Revision: https://reviews.freebsd.org/D22985
Notes
Notes: svn path=/head/; revision=356289
Diffstat (limited to 'Makefile.inc1')
-rw-r--r--Makefile.inc12
1 files changed, 2 insertions, 0 deletions
diff --git a/Makefile.inc1 b/Makefile.inc1
index 2d2a5295ac227..bfcb0a70189f7 100644
--- a/Makefile.inc1
+++ b/Makefile.inc1
@@ -62,6 +62,8 @@ LOCALBASE?= /usr/local
.if defined(CROSS_TOOLCHAIN)
.if exists(${LOCALBASE}/share/toolchains/${CROSS_TOOLCHAIN}.mk)
.include "${LOCALBASE}/share/toolchains/${CROSS_TOOLCHAIN}.mk"
+.elif exists(/usr/share/toolchains/${CROSS_TOOLCHAIN}.mk)
+.include "/usr/share/toolchains/${CROSS_TOOLCHAIN}.mk"
.elif exists(${CROSS_TOOLCHAIN})
.include "${CROSS_TOOLCHAIN}"
.else